Section 41AA of the Retirement Villages Act 1986 prohibits a person from promoting or selling rights to occupy premises in a retirement village, or from taking part in or being concerned in a village’s management in any way, directly or indirectly, if they:
- are an insolvent under administration; or
- have been convicted of an offence involving fraud or dishonesty in the last 5 years (or finished a sentence of imprisonment for a dishonesty offence in the last 5 years).
A dishonesty offence is an offence involving fraud or dishonesty punishable on conviction by imprisonment for more than 3 months, whether the conviction is in or outside Victoria.
It is an offence to breach these requirements and penalties apply.
